How do I select the very best hair dye colour for layered hair?
- Pores and skin tone: Heat pores and skin tones look good with heat shades like honey blonde or copper, whereas cool pores and skin tones go well with cooler shades like ash blonde or burgundy.
- Hair texture: Positive hair can profit from lighter shades that add quantity, whereas thick hair can deal with darker shades that add definition.
- Layering model: Lengthy layers can help bolder colours and patterns, whereas brief layers want extra refined or blended shades.
- Private desire: In the end, select a colour that displays your persona and elegance.
How do I preserve hair dye on layered hair?
- Use color-safe shampoo and conditioner.
- Use warmth protectant spray earlier than styling.
- Keep away from over-washing your hair.
- Get common trims to take away break up ends and preserve the layered form.
- Think about using a color-depositing conditioner to refresh the colour in between salon visits.
How usually ought to I re-color layered hair?
- Balayage, ombré, and dip-dye: Each 3-6 months or as wanted to take care of the meant transition.
- Highlights and lowlights: Each 6-8 weeks or as wanted to the touch up roots and refresh the colour.
- Inventive or daring colours: Extra frequent touch-ups could also be required relying on fading and elegance.
